大家好今天我们要聊的话题是每个Python新手都会遇到的第一个问题如何运行Python程序也许你已经安装了Python但对着黑色的命令行窗口不知所措也许你听说过PyCharm、VS Code这些高大上的工具却不知道它们有什么用。别担心这篇文章将带你一次性搞懂Python程序的三种运行方式——交互式命令行、脚本模式、IDE模式。我会用最通俗的语言、最详细的步骤让你从零开始亲手跑起第一个Python程序。为什么需要多种运行方式在深入之前我们先思考一个问题写代码就像写菜谱运行代码就像按照菜谱做菜。不同的场景下我们需要不同的“做菜方式”如果你想快速试验一个小想法就像尝一口调料那么交互式命令行最合适。如果你想写一个完整的程序保存下来反复使用或分享给别人那么脚本模式是基础。如果你要开发大型项目需要代码提示、调试、版本管理等高级功能那么IDE就是你的瑞士军刀。理解了这些我们就开始吧一、交互式命令行模式像聊天一样写代码交互式模式是Python提供的最直接、最简单的运行方式。你打开一个“对话窗口”输入一行代码Python立即执行并返回结果就像和朋友聊天一样。1. 如何进入交互式环境Windows系统以Win10/Win11为例按下键盘上的Win键 R打开“运行”对话框。输入cmd然后回车打开命令提示符窗口那个黑乎乎的窗口。在命令提示符中输入python然后回车。如果Python安装正确你会看到类似这样的信息textPython 3.11.5 (tags/v3.11.5:...) Type help, copyright, credits or license for more information. 那三个大于号就是Python的提示符表示它正在等待你的指令。小贴士如果输入python后提示“不是内部或外部命令”说明Python没有添加到系统环境变量中。这时候需要重新安装Python并勾选“Add Python to PATH”。2. 写第一行代码在后面输入pythonprint(hello)然后回车。你会看到屏幕上立刻打印出texthello恭喜你已经成功运行了第一个Python程序。3. 交互式模式的特点与使用场景即时反馈每输入一行代码立即看到结果非常适合学习语法、测试小功能。临时计算器可以把它当做一个强大的计算器使用比如输入3 * 5回车立刻得到15。探索性编程当你不知道某个函数怎么用时可以在交互式环境里试试。要退出交互式模式可以输入exit()或按CtrlZ再回车Windows或者CtrlDMac/Linux。二、脚本模式把代码写进文件一次编写多次运行交互式模式虽然方便但代码无法保存。一旦关闭窗口刚才写的东西就丢了。如果你想写一个完整的程序比如一个计算器、一个小游戏就需要用到脚本模式。1. 创建你的第一个Python脚本文件Python脚本文件通常以.py作为扩展名。我们可以在任意位置创建一个文件夹用来存放代码。步骤演示在电脑的E盘下创建一个名为Hello的文件夹路径E:\Hello。在这个文件夹里新建一个文本文件重命名为hello.py。注意扩展名一定要是.py而不是.txt。用记事本或任何文本编辑器打开hello.py写入pythonprint(hello)保存文件。现在你有了一个Python脚本。2. 通过命令行运行脚本我们需要打开命令提示符并切换到脚本所在的文件夹。方法一在资源管理器直接打开命令行打开E:\Hello文件夹在地址栏文件夹路径那里输入cmd然后回车。神奇的事情发生了命令提示符直接打开了并且当前路径就是E:\Hello。方法二手动切换目录如果已经打开了命令提示符可以通过以下命令进入目标文件夹cmde: cd Hello第一行e:是切换到E盘因为默认在C盘用户目录第二行cd Hello是进入Hello文件夹。3. 执行脚本在命令提示符中输入cmdpython hello.py然后回车。你会看到输出texthello大功告成你刚刚用脚本模式运行了Python程序。4. 脚本模式的优势代码可保存文件可以随时修改、重复运行。便于分享把.py文件发给别人他们就可以运行你的程序。适合完整项目可以写几百行、几千行代码组织成模块。三、IDE模式专业开发者的利器随着学习的深入你会发现用记事本写代码很痛苦没有代码高亮、没有自动补全、没有调试工具……这时候就需要IDE集成开发环境登场了。市面上有很多优秀的Python IDE比如PyCharm、VS Code、Jupyter Notebook等。这里我们以最流行的PyCharm为例带你感受IDE的强大。1. 安装和新建项目假设你已经安装了PyCharm社区版免费。打开PyCharm点击“New Project”给项目取个名字比如python-2026。选择项目存放的位置比如D:\dev\workspace\python-2026。PyCharm会自动创建一个虚拟环境.venv用来隔离项目的依赖包这是很好的习惯。点击“Create”等待项目初始化完成。项目结构大概长这样textpython-2026/ ├── .venv/ # 虚拟环境包含Python解释器和库 ├── External Libraries └── Scratches and Consoles2. 创建第一个Python文件在项目根目录上右键选择New → Directory创建一个新的目录命名为chapter02。然后右键点击chapter02目录选择New → Python File输入文件名01_HelloWord注意不用加.pyPyCharm会自动添加。文件创建后编辑区自动打开输入pythonprint(hello world)3. 运行程序在编辑区的任意位置右键你会看到菜单中有Run 01_HelloWord选项点击它。或者你也可以点击右上角的绿色三角形按钮运行。运行后PyCharm底部的控制台会显示输出textD:\dev\workspace\python-2026\.venv\Scripts\python.exe D:\dev\workspace\python-2025\chapter02\01_HelloWord.py hello world Process finished with exit code 0看到了吗它不仅打印了“hello world”还显示了程序运行的完整路径和退出状态。exit code 0表示程序正常结束。4. IDE模式为什么是未来最常用的方式代码智能提示你输入pri它会自动提示print减少拼写错误。调试功能可以设置断点一步步查看代码执行过程快速定位Bug。项目管理可以轻松管理多个文件、第三方库、版本控制Git等。集成工具终端、文件浏览器、代码格式化、重构等功能一应俱全。对于初学者来说IDE可能一开始有些复杂但相信我一旦习惯你会爱不释手。总结三种方式各有所长运行方式特点适用场景交互式命令行即输即得无需创建文件学习语法、测试小功能、快速计算脚本模式代码可保存可重复运行编写完整程序、处理数据、自动化任务IDE模式功能强大开发效率高大型项目、团队协作、复杂调试作为初学者我建议你这样开始先用交互式模式熟悉Python的基本语法感受一下“代码即写即执行”的乐趣。然后用脚本模式写几个小项目比如猜数字、计算器体验完整的编程流程。当你觉得记事本不够用了果断转入IDE模式用PyCharm或VS Code开启真正的开发之旅。无论哪种方式最重要的永远是动手去写、去试、去犯错。编程是一门手艺只有不断练习才能精进。希望这篇文章能帮你跨出第一步欢迎在评论区分享你运行第一个Python程序的故事记住只要打开了Python的大门无限可能就在眼前。
Python入门必看:3种运行Python程序的方式,从零到上手
大家好今天我们要聊的话题是每个Python新手都会遇到的第一个问题如何运行Python程序也许你已经安装了Python但对着黑色的命令行窗口不知所措也许你听说过PyCharm、VS Code这些高大上的工具却不知道它们有什么用。别担心这篇文章将带你一次性搞懂Python程序的三种运行方式——交互式命令行、脚本模式、IDE模式。我会用最通俗的语言、最详细的步骤让你从零开始亲手跑起第一个Python程序。为什么需要多种运行方式在深入之前我们先思考一个问题写代码就像写菜谱运行代码就像按照菜谱做菜。不同的场景下我们需要不同的“做菜方式”如果你想快速试验一个小想法就像尝一口调料那么交互式命令行最合适。如果你想写一个完整的程序保存下来反复使用或分享给别人那么脚本模式是基础。如果你要开发大型项目需要代码提示、调试、版本管理等高级功能那么IDE就是你的瑞士军刀。理解了这些我们就开始吧一、交互式命令行模式像聊天一样写代码交互式模式是Python提供的最直接、最简单的运行方式。你打开一个“对话窗口”输入一行代码Python立即执行并返回结果就像和朋友聊天一样。1. 如何进入交互式环境Windows系统以Win10/Win11为例按下键盘上的Win键 R打开“运行”对话框。输入cmd然后回车打开命令提示符窗口那个黑乎乎的窗口。在命令提示符中输入python然后回车。如果Python安装正确你会看到类似这样的信息textPython 3.11.5 (tags/v3.11.5:...) Type help, copyright, credits or license for more information. 那三个大于号就是Python的提示符表示它正在等待你的指令。小贴士如果输入python后提示“不是内部或外部命令”说明Python没有添加到系统环境变量中。这时候需要重新安装Python并勾选“Add Python to PATH”。2. 写第一行代码在后面输入pythonprint(hello)然后回车。你会看到屏幕上立刻打印出texthello恭喜你已经成功运行了第一个Python程序。3. 交互式模式的特点与使用场景即时反馈每输入一行代码立即看到结果非常适合学习语法、测试小功能。临时计算器可以把它当做一个强大的计算器使用比如输入3 * 5回车立刻得到15。探索性编程当你不知道某个函数怎么用时可以在交互式环境里试试。要退出交互式模式可以输入exit()或按CtrlZ再回车Windows或者CtrlDMac/Linux。二、脚本模式把代码写进文件一次编写多次运行交互式模式虽然方便但代码无法保存。一旦关闭窗口刚才写的东西就丢了。如果你想写一个完整的程序比如一个计算器、一个小游戏就需要用到脚本模式。1. 创建你的第一个Python脚本文件Python脚本文件通常以.py作为扩展名。我们可以在任意位置创建一个文件夹用来存放代码。步骤演示在电脑的E盘下创建一个名为Hello的文件夹路径E:\Hello。在这个文件夹里新建一个文本文件重命名为hello.py。注意扩展名一定要是.py而不是.txt。用记事本或任何文本编辑器打开hello.py写入pythonprint(hello)保存文件。现在你有了一个Python脚本。2. 通过命令行运行脚本我们需要打开命令提示符并切换到脚本所在的文件夹。方法一在资源管理器直接打开命令行打开E:\Hello文件夹在地址栏文件夹路径那里输入cmd然后回车。神奇的事情发生了命令提示符直接打开了并且当前路径就是E:\Hello。方法二手动切换目录如果已经打开了命令提示符可以通过以下命令进入目标文件夹cmde: cd Hello第一行e:是切换到E盘因为默认在C盘用户目录第二行cd Hello是进入Hello文件夹。3. 执行脚本在命令提示符中输入cmdpython hello.py然后回车。你会看到输出texthello大功告成你刚刚用脚本模式运行了Python程序。4. 脚本模式的优势代码可保存文件可以随时修改、重复运行。便于分享把.py文件发给别人他们就可以运行你的程序。适合完整项目可以写几百行、几千行代码组织成模块。三、IDE模式专业开发者的利器随着学习的深入你会发现用记事本写代码很痛苦没有代码高亮、没有自动补全、没有调试工具……这时候就需要IDE集成开发环境登场了。市面上有很多优秀的Python IDE比如PyCharm、VS Code、Jupyter Notebook等。这里我们以最流行的PyCharm为例带你感受IDE的强大。1. 安装和新建项目假设你已经安装了PyCharm社区版免费。打开PyCharm点击“New Project”给项目取个名字比如python-2026。选择项目存放的位置比如D:\dev\workspace\python-2026。PyCharm会自动创建一个虚拟环境.venv用来隔离项目的依赖包这是很好的习惯。点击“Create”等待项目初始化完成。项目结构大概长这样textpython-2026/ ├── .venv/ # 虚拟环境包含Python解释器和库 ├── External Libraries └── Scratches and Consoles2. 创建第一个Python文件在项目根目录上右键选择New → Directory创建一个新的目录命名为chapter02。然后右键点击chapter02目录选择New → Python File输入文件名01_HelloWord注意不用加.pyPyCharm会自动添加。文件创建后编辑区自动打开输入pythonprint(hello world)3. 运行程序在编辑区的任意位置右键你会看到菜单中有Run 01_HelloWord选项点击它。或者你也可以点击右上角的绿色三角形按钮运行。运行后PyCharm底部的控制台会显示输出textD:\dev\workspace\python-2026\.venv\Scripts\python.exe D:\dev\workspace\python-2025\chapter02\01_HelloWord.py hello world Process finished with exit code 0看到了吗它不仅打印了“hello world”还显示了程序运行的完整路径和退出状态。exit code 0表示程序正常结束。4. IDE模式为什么是未来最常用的方式代码智能提示你输入pri它会自动提示print减少拼写错误。调试功能可以设置断点一步步查看代码执行过程快速定位Bug。项目管理可以轻松管理多个文件、第三方库、版本控制Git等。集成工具终端、文件浏览器、代码格式化、重构等功能一应俱全。对于初学者来说IDE可能一开始有些复杂但相信我一旦习惯你会爱不释手。总结三种方式各有所长运行方式特点适用场景交互式命令行即输即得无需创建文件学习语法、测试小功能、快速计算脚本模式代码可保存可重复运行编写完整程序、处理数据、自动化任务IDE模式功能强大开发效率高大型项目、团队协作、复杂调试作为初学者我建议你这样开始先用交互式模式熟悉Python的基本语法感受一下“代码即写即执行”的乐趣。然后用脚本模式写几个小项目比如猜数字、计算器体验完整的编程流程。当你觉得记事本不够用了果断转入IDE模式用PyCharm或VS Code开启真正的开发之旅。无论哪种方式最重要的永远是动手去写、去试、去犯错。编程是一门手艺只有不断练习才能精进。希望这篇文章能帮你跨出第一步欢迎在评论区分享你运行第一个Python程序的故事记住只要打开了Python的大门无限可能就在眼前。